The Apollo Project page was going to be a timeline of all the Apollo missions, so I first needed to prepare the content for each mission. I used these cards for each mission, which resembled document files which was a light but effective aesthetic for this specific page. I also prepped images for each mission.

Next I created a wireframe of when the timeline and content was going to sit, and began layering up with same visual aspects as before.

The finished screen was simple but worked well I thought. I liked that it only gave light detail about each mission, rather than overloading on content. This was more of an extra page rather than a whole feature of the prototype so didn’t need too much content.

For functionality, I used masks and arrow buttons which would move from point to point along the timeline. It would also slide along once it went to a point which was off screen, which was achieved easily through multiple screens and smart animation.
